The Martinez Brothers Bring North American Tour to Atlanta

The popular DJ duo will perform a 3-hour set at District Atlanta on March 7, 2026.

Published on Mar. 8, 2026

The Martinez Brothers, a renowned DJ duo, are bringing their North American tour to District Atlanta on Saturday, March 7, 2026. The event, organized by Liquified & Collectiv Presents, will feature a 3-hour performance by the brothers, who are known for their energetic and genre-blending sets.

The details

The Martinez Brothers, composed of Chris and Steve Martinez, have been making waves in the electronic music industry for over a decade. Their unique sound, which blends house, techno, and Latin rhythms, has earned them a loyal following and numerous accolades. The event at District Atlanta will feature a 3-hour set by the duo, showcasing their signature style and energetic performance.

  • The Martinez Brothers will perform at District Atlanta on Saturday, March 7, 2026, from 9 PM to 12 AM.
